Audemars Piguet Royal Oaks

The Audemars Piguet Royal Oak redefined modern watchmaking in 1972 with its bold octagonal bezel, exposed screws, and integrated bracelet—design details that challenged tradition and became icons in their own right. Born from a need to merge sport and luxury, it quickly achieved cult status.
